Based on 14 job listings - Cleveland, United States 2026
Cleveland
Average salary
34,190 - 49,575
Median salary
34,190 - 49,575
14 job openings
United States
Average salary
45,500 - 54,694
Median salary
45,500 - 54,694
14,401 job openings
The average salary for a Maintenance Worker in Cleveland, United States is USD 34,190 - USD 49,575 per year in 2026, based on 14 job listings.
Explore 14 Maintenance Worker job listings in United States on BeBee, or check our salary calculator for a personalized estimate.